January 14 2004, Wednesday, 6.30pm for 7.15pm-9pm

HOTEL HOSTS CHRISTOPHER ALLAN'S FASHION TALK, "ROBES OF THE REALM," FOR VISITORS, GUESTS & MEMBERS OF "LONDON ASHRIDGE CIRCLE" - SOCIETY NAMED AFTER ASHRIDGE PARK, IN HERTFORDSHIRE

The London Ashridge Circle, named after a College of Citizenship in Ashridge Park, Hertfordshire, was founded in 1949 and each month, between September and May, it organises a general interest talk (amongst many other events, which include music evenings at members' homes and walks). This evening - a month or so before their own AGM (when there will be a talk about the Middle East) - it is the turn of Christopher Allan, who will inform all those attending literally everything about formal ceremonial dress, which includes what we wear at weddings.
